Jack, Steve, Daniel, and Mark are friends. On the basis of their diets and physical activity levels, who is most likely to becom

e a type-2 diabetic later in life? A. Daniel loves junk food. He is on the school soccer team. B. Jack eats nutritious food most of the time but indulges in junk food once in a while. C. Mark prefers nutritious food, helps his father in the garden, and walks his dog regularly. D. Steve loves junk food and hates any kind of physical activity.

The answer is: <em>D) Steve loves junk food and hates any kind of activity</em>.

<em>Explanation:</em>

A) Daniel loved junk food. He is in the school soccer team. This answer is incorrect because, Daniel may eat junk food but he burns the carories off while doing sport's.

B) Jack eats nutritious food most of the time but indulges junk food some times. This answer would be incorrect because, he mainly eats healthy food and he doesn't consume indulge junk food all the time.

C) Mark prefers nutritious food, helps his father in the garden, and walks his dog regularly. This answer would be incorrect because, he prefers healthy food and any junk food he consumes, he would most likley burn the calories off because he's exercising when he takes his dog out, and he doesn't sit around doing nothing.

D) Steve loves junk food and hates any kind of physical activity. This answer would be correct because, he isn't doing anything proactive, and hes eating junk food all the time.


That being said, <em>D)  Steve loves junk food and hates any kind of physical activity</em>. Is the correct answer.
